Hrrmm. Well I have a D16Z6 block with the stock pistons (P28) and Im going to be puttin a Y8 head on. I have a compression calulator web page that I have found and it says, with this setup Im only going to be running 9.1 compression. I have a D15B2 block and for giggles I enterd the D15 pistons (PM3) and it says with those pistons I will be running 11.1 compression on a Z6 block and a Y8 head. Is this somewhat accurate? I will try to clear this up a lil.

D16Z6 block P28 pistons - Y8 head = 9.1 CR
D16Z6 block PM3 pistons - Y8 head = 11.1 CR

So obviously go with the PM3 pistons?
